Compare Temecula to Manhattan Beach

This post compares Temecula, California to Manhattan Beach, California across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ension Temecula (city) Manhattan Beach (city)
Population 110,722 35,698
Income (median) $59,886 $118,119
Home Value (median) $394,600 $1,694,900
White 69% 79%
Black 5% 0%
Asian 9% 10%
With Kids 45% 32%
Age (median) 34 43
Rentals 35% 31%
